Amiro Art & Found is a unique art gallery in the heart of Saint Augustine, FL, showcasing a diverse collection of contemporary and traditional artwork.
With a focus on promoting local artists and fostering creativity, this establishment offers a welcoming space for art enthusiasts to explore and appreciate various forms of artistic expression.
Generated from their business information